Antivirus software program uses signatures to detect and counteract viruses. These signatures will be stored in a database, and they can be regularly current by cybersecurity vendors to ensure that they capture new and evolving threats.
Signature-based detection is considered the most common and tried and tested way of detecting infections. It determines for a certain digital fingerprint that matches a known malwares strain. It also tries to detect a wide variety of viruses, so the program should be able to capture the majority of known trojans variants and avoid untrue positives.
Drawback to this technique is that it requires the software to get updated frequently as programmers change the code of infections to avoid getting caught. Another way of detecting spyware is to use heuristics. These are a variety of algorithms and other methods that are designed to search for patterns in the behavior of your computer’s documents, programs, and websites. Heuristics may be more effective with regards to identifying new and growing threats.
